Output 59d33755c296ef98d7d220aa74413ba16f0ba172ad9c8e0b2a783056f51a753e:17

value
76785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 287b986836088534d42ebd3d0951c33b1d6c580e OP_EQUAL
address
35P51miRwz5MmycPRgyLT8GPPd3meodbXi
transaction
59d33755c296ef98d7d220aa74413ba16f0ba172ad9c8e0b2a783056f51a753e
spent
true